Description

Take flight with a scientific adventure spanning not only thousands of miles, but generations. Discover what makes the spectacular Monarch butterfly (Danaus plexippus) migration one of the most incredible such events on Earth.

Follow a Monarch on her perilous journey from Mexico to Canada, along with her daughter, granddaughter, and great-granddaughter. The outstanding fourth, or "Super Generation" of butterflies travels south, from the northern United States and southern Canada to Mexico, overwinters, and makes one final short trip to the southern United States to lay eggs. Then, the cycle begins anew. It's one adventure you won't want to miss!
